Distinct Biological Pathways Drive Restrictive and Obstructive Post-Tuberculosis Lung Disease: Insights from a Kenyan Cohort

Posted by MedXY By MedXY 03/24/2026
A prospective Kenyan cohort study identifies that post-tuberculosis lung disease (PTLD) affects 50% of survivors, driven by divergent transcriptomic signatures: early pro-fibrotic inflammation in restrictive phenotypes and persistent interferon signaling in obstructive phenotypes.
